Statue of Liberty to be closed for an year for renovations
Visitors can still visit Liberty Island in the New York harbour as it will remain open during upgrades over the next year.
The statue has undergone many physical changes, and has been administered by various departments over its history. It's now managed by the National Park Service.
The statue was closed after the 11 September terror attacks for security precautions, but the base reopened in 2004 after a $20m security upgrade. The observation deck at the top of the crown was reopened on 4 July 2009.
